Contador is officially the team captain and rides with the lowest number on his back (21). However, Armstrong who - when in his prime - used to rule supremely like a "dictator" on his team, now believes that it's only natural for a team "to have multiple captains". Armstrong only rides for himself and therefore there is indeed a conflict of interest within the Astana team.
In fact, I find it more than likely that we'll see 3 Astana riders on the podium in Paris. As I've already stated, Contador is my overwhelming favourite but Armstrong can never be counted out, even if he's turned 37.
